About the Artist
Helene Fischer is more than just a singer; she's a global phenomenon. Born in Krasnoyarsk, Russia, and raised in Germany, Fischer's meteoric rise to fame began in the early 2000s. Her distinctive musical style, a vibrant fusion of traditional German schlager with modern pop sensibilities, has earned her a dedicated fanbase and critical acclaim. She's known for her powerful vocals, energetic stage presence, and elaborate stage productions that rival those of international pop superstars. Over her illustrious career, she has released numerous platinum-selling albums, broken sales records, and won countless awards, solidifying her status as one of the most successful German artists of all time. Hits like 'Atemlos durch die Nacht', 'Herzbeben', and 'Ich will immer wieder mein Leben spüren' are anthems that resonate deeply with her audience, creating an electric atmosphere at every concert. Her ability to connect with her fans, combined with her unparalleled showmanship, makes each of her performances a truly special event.
The Venue
The Deutsche Bank Park in Frankfurt am Main is the perfect setting for a concert of this magnitude. Formerly known as the Waldstadion, this state-of-the-art stadium boasts a retractable roof, ensuring that the show goes on, whatever the weather. With a capacity of over 50,000 for concerts, it offers a fantastic atmosphere and excellent acoustics, allowing every fan to feel part of the action. The venue is well-equipped with modern facilities, including numerous food and beverage outlets, merchandise stands, and easily accessible seating and standing areas. Its strategic location on the outskirts of Frankfurt makes it a popular choice for major international artists and sporting events, promising a seamless experience for attendees.
